Searched refs:ams_irq (Results 1 - 9 of 9) sorted by relevance
/kernel/linux/linux-5.10/drivers/macintosh/ams/ |
H A D | ams-core.c | 60 enum ams_irq irq = *((enum ams_irq *)data); in ams_handle_irq() 70 static enum ams_irq ams_freefall_irq_data = AMS_IRQ_FREEFALL; 77 static enum ams_irq ams_shock_irq_data = AMS_IRQ_SHOCK;
|
H A D | ams.h | 10 enum ams_irq { enum 46 void (*clear_irq)(enum ams_irq reg);
|
H A D | ams-pmu.c | 79 static void ams_pmu_set_irq(enum ams_irq reg, char enable) in ams_pmu_set_irq() 109 static void ams_pmu_clear_irq(enum ams_irq reg) in ams_pmu_clear_irq()
|
H A D | ams-i2c.c | 107 static void ams_i2c_set_irq(enum ams_irq reg, char enable) in ams_i2c_set_irq() 137 static void ams_i2c_clear_irq(enum ams_irq reg) in ams_i2c_clear_irq()
|
/kernel/linux/linux-6.6/drivers/macintosh/ams/ |
H A D | ams-core.c | 60 enum ams_irq irq = *((enum ams_irq *)data); in ams_handle_irq() 70 static enum ams_irq ams_freefall_irq_data = AMS_IRQ_FREEFALL; 77 static enum ams_irq ams_shock_irq_data = AMS_IRQ_SHOCK;
|
H A D | ams.h | 13 enum ams_irq { enum 49 void (*clear_irq)(enum ams_irq reg);
|
H A D | ams-pmu.c | 79 static void ams_pmu_set_irq(enum ams_irq reg, char enable) in ams_pmu_set_irq() 109 static void ams_pmu_clear_irq(enum ams_irq reg) in ams_pmu_clear_irq()
|
H A D | ams-i2c.c | 106 static void ams_i2c_set_irq(enum ams_irq reg, char enable) in ams_i2c_set_irq() 136 static void ams_i2c_clear_irq(enum ams_irq reg) in ams_i2c_clear_irq()
|
/kernel/linux/linux-6.6/drivers/iio/adc/ |
H A D | xilinx-ams.c | 1054 static irqreturn_t ams_irq(int irq, void *data) in ams_irq() function 1395 ret = devm_request_irq(&pdev->dev, irq, &ams_irq, 0, "ams-irq", in ams_probe()
|
Completed in 9 milliseconds